(240115) -- WUHAN, Jan. 15, 2024 (Xinhua) -- Instructor Wang Kuolin (1st L) teaches students how to play the ukulele during a night school class in Hanyang District of Wuhan, central China's Hubei Province, Jan. 10, 2024. Night classes were very popular in China in the 1980s, when many young people sought to learn new skills to make a living. Today, these classes are gaining popularity again among China's younger generations, meeting their needs for an enriched lifestyle. In late November, a night school for young people was launched by the Wuhan municipal committee of the Communist Youth League of China and soon won youngsters' hearts, with all nine courses set in the first phase fully applied for. Now the night school classes are available all around Wuhan, serving more than 3,000 attendees with a variety of courses, such as calligraphy, Chinese painting, yoga, baking, latte art, jazz dance, ukulele and the like.
